+* **Support ethernet device hotplug for primary-secondary model.**
+
+  In primary-secondary process model, ethernet devices are regarded as shared
+  by default, attach or detach a device on any process will broadcast to
+  other processes through mp channel then device information will be
+  synchronzied on all processes. While secondary process can still attach
+  or detach a private device (vdev only) with specific API.
+
+* **Support ethernet device lock.**
+
+  An ethernet device can be directly or conditionally locked. A directly
+  locked device can't be detached, while when try to detach a conditionally
+  locked device a pre-registered callback will be invoked to perform condition
+  check and decide if it can be detached or not.

+* ethdev: scope of rte_eth_dev_attach and rte_eth_dev_detach is extended.
+
+  In primary-secondary process model, ``rte_eth_dev_attach`` will guarantee that
+  device be attached on all processes, if any process failed to attach, it will
+  rollback to orignal status. ``rte_eth_dev_detach`` also guarantee device be
+  detached on all processes, if device is locked by any process, it will roll
+  back to original status.
